WebMay 4, 2016 · The earthworm is an example of a foraging herbivorous annelid, obtaining food by eating its way through the soil and extracting nutrients from the soil as it passes … WebMay 4, 2016 · The earthworm is an example of a foraging herbivorous annelid, obtaining food by eating its way through the soil and extracting nutrients from the soil as it passes through the digestive tract. The earthworm takes in a mixture of soil and organic matter through its mouth, which is the beginning of the digestive tract. WebThis lesson plan describes the earthworm dissection in detail.
